< Esdræ 1 >

1 In anno primo Cyri regis Persarum ut compleretur verbum Domini ex ore Ieremiæ, suscitavit Dominus spiritum Cyri regis Persarum: et traduxit vocem in omni regno suo, etiam per scripturam, dicens:
In the first year of Cyrus, king of Persia, to fulfil the word of Yahweh from the mouth of Jeremiah, Yahweh aroused the spirit of Cyrus, king of Persia, and he made a proclamation throughout all his kingdom, moreover also in writing, saying:
2 Hæc dicit Cyrus rex Persarum: Omnia regna terræ dedit mihi Dominus Deus cæli, et ipse præcepit mihi ut ædificarem ei domum in Ierusalem, quæ est in Iudæa.
Thus, saith Cyrus, king of Persia, All the kingdoms of the earth, hath Yahweh God of the heavens, given to me, —and, he himself, hath laid charge upon me, to build for him a house, in Jerusalem, which is in Judah.
3 Quis est in vobis de universo populo eius? Sit Deus illius cum ipso. Ascendat in Ierusalem, quæ est in Iudæa, et ædificet domum Domini Dei Israel, ipse est Deus qui est in Ierusalem.
Who is there among you of all his people? His God be with him, and let him go up to Jerusalem, which is in Judah, —and build the house of Yahweh God of Israel, (he, is God!) which is in Jerusalem;
4 Et omnes reliqui in cunctis locis ubicumque habitant, adiuvent eum viri de loco suo argento et auro, et substantia, et pecoribus, excepto quod voluntarie offerunt templo Dei, quod est in Ierusalem.
And, whosoever is left, of all the places where he doth sojourn, let the men of his place uphold him, with silver and with gold, and with goods and with beasts, —along with a voluntary offering for the house of God, which is in Jerusalem.
5 Et surrexerunt principes patrum de Iuda, et Beniamin, et Sacerdotes, et Levitæ, et omnis, cuius Deus suscitavit spiritum, ut ascenderent ad ædificandum templum Domini, quod erat in Ierusalem.
Then arose the ancestral chiefs of Judah and Benjamin, and the priests, and the Levites, —even every one whose spirit God had aroused, to go up to build the house of Yahweh, which was in Jerusalem;
6 Universique qui erant in circuitu, adiuverunt manus eorum in vasis argenteis et aureis, in substantia et iumentis, in supellectili, exceptis his, quæ sponte obtulerant.
and, all they who were round about them, strengthened their hands, with utensils of silver, with gold with goods and with beasts, and with precious things, —besides any thing he had volunteered.
7 Rex quoque Cyrus protulit vasa templi Domini, quæ tulerat Nabuchodonosor de Ierusalem, et posuerat ea in templo dei sui.
And, King Cyrus, brought forth the utensils of the house of Yahweh, —which Nebuchadnezzar had brought forth from Jerusalem, and put in the house of his gods: —
8 Protulit autem ea Cyrus rex Persarum per manum Mithridatis filii gazabar, et annumeravit ea Sassabasar principi Iuda.
yea Cyrus king of Persia brought them forth, by the hand of Mithredath the treasurer, —and numbered them unto Sheshbazzar, a leader of Judah.
9 Et hic est numerus eorum: phialæ aureæ triginta, phialæ argenteæ mille, cultri viginti novem, scyphi aurei triginta,
And, these, were the numbers of them, —basins of gold, thirty, basins of silver, a thousand, knives, twenty-nine;
10 scyphi argentei secundi quadringenti decem: vasa alia mille.
bowls of gold, thirty, bowls of silver, of a secondary sort, four hundred and ten, —other utensils, a thousand.
11 Omnia vasa aurea et argentea quinque millia quadringenta: universa tulit Sassabasar cum his, qui ascendebant de transmigratione Babylonis in Ierusalem.
All the utensils, in gold and silver, were five thousand and four hundred, —the whole, did Sheshbazzar bring up with the upbringing of the exile, out of Babylon unto Jerusalem.
